The 304th birth anniversary of the late King Prithvi Narayan Shah, the founder of modern Nepal, was observed across the country on Sunday, January 11.
The day, marked as National Unity Day, was commemorated with statue cleaning and garlanding ceremonies in various places.
In Kathmandu, an official programme was held in the morning with a wreath-laying ceremony at Prithvi Narayan Shah’s statue in front of the western gate of Singha Durbar.
President Ram Chandra Paudel, Vice President Ramsahay Prasad Yadav, Prime Minister Sushila Karki, and members of the public attended the event.
Participants paid floral tributes to the statue, honouring Shah’s contribution to national unification and state-building.
